The 18-acre fire started near Queenstone and Ponte fire roads on Aug. 13.
A fire truck heads toward a wildland fire in the Marinwood neighborhood of San Rafael, Calif. on Tuesday morning, Aug. 13, 2024. The Queenstone Fire was reported shortly after 4 a.m. Judge Kelly Simmons suspended criminal proceedings for Colin Crook, 34, a homeless resident, and ordered him to undergo a mental competency examination to see if he’s fit to stand trial. He remains in custody at Marin County Jail, where his bail was set at $12,000.
The Marin County Sheriff’s Office reported that Crook burned his tent and tried to extinguish the flames but he left before ensuring the fire was out.Crook’s public defender, Jeff Mitchell, and prosecutor Rachel Minarovich declined to comment after the hearing.
